Output d24a425789d0dcc20135eeb7a5afff1f3cd0a156ea6b1dccc3b377a53bf4e546:1

value
767659
script pubkey
OP_0 OP_PUSHBYTES_20 52974378aacfe1a80c6cee37ae38cb40ee0b9968
address
bc1q22t5x792els6srrvacm6uwxtgrhqhxtgupf9m4
transaction
d24a425789d0dcc20135eeb7a5afff1f3cd0a156ea6b1dccc3b377a53bf4e546
confirmations
9110
spent
true